Lftp tutorial linux pdf

For example, to examine the file that defines all the systems user accounts, enter. Alternative script for lftp command hi, i was looking for a command which would help sending files parallely to remote server, and lftp is the closest option i could got. Do i have to use local server, get and put commands for this. But, on a professional level, lftp is becoming a superreliable option for me when automating ftp transfers with script. This tutorial teaches mainly through examples in order to help quickly explain the concepts in the book. You can also use ftp to transfer files from one computer to. Using lftp as ftp client to mirror directories, download files and upload files to ftp server on ubuntu 16. Unfortunately when i checked the aix machine i work on does not has lftp installed. Hi, i was looking for a command which would help sending files parallely to remote server, and lftp is the closest option i could got. If the site url is specified, then lftp will connect to that site otherwise a connection has to be established with the open command.

I will show you how to connect to an ftp server, up and download files and create directories. The solution is simple however a bit unsafe as the password is given explicitly as text, like below. Feb 29, 2020 sophisticated command line file transfer program ftp, sftp, fish, torrent lavv17lftp. Searching for data on one sheet and pull the searched. Makefile syntax a makefile consists of a set of rules. How to use lftp command for ftps client or to connect using ssltls. Aug 01, 2015 lftp is a commandline file transfer program ftp client for unix and unixlike systems.

How to mirror files from a remote ftp server get files. Home forums linux forums programmingscripts tutorials. How to install programs on linux fedora 29 tutorial. Thanks for the answer, but i was asking asking how to copy file on remote server, not to the remote server. Initially linux was intended to develop into an operating system of its own, but these plans were shelved somewhere along the way. How to use lftp to accelerate ftps download speed on linuxunix last updated february 2, 2018 in categories centos, debian linux, freebsd, gentoo linux l ftp is a file transfer program. It has bookmarks, builtin mirroring, and can transfer several files in parallel. Very well designed program that offers dramatic productivity boost for knowledgeable admin and advanced users who need to use ftp often. Ftp, or file transfer protocol is a popular method of transferring files between two remote systems. This fedora 29 tutorial is for those that want to know all the different ways and the best way i. Dec 05, 2016 12 lftp commands to manage files with examples december 5, 2016 updated january 12, 2020 by mihajlo milenovic linux howto today we are going to install lftp, which is a command line ftp client.

Lftp works on command line shell or right from the bash shell. It uses the accessibility libraries to poke through the applications user interface. Bash shell is particularly useful if you are going to write a script that uses lftp. See examples that illustrate typical uses of the ftp linux command for remotely copying, renaming, and deleting files.

It is an essential tool for all a linux unix command line users. Im trying to delete a file from an ftp server in my shell scrip using lftp, but for some reason it will not use my variables, and takes them as literals. Using lftp with ftps explicit ssl encryption unixdude. Unix, linux commands advertisements unix commands reference. Besides ftplike protocols, lftp has support for bittorrent protocol as torrent. While there are many nice desktops ftp clients available, the ftp command is still useful when you work remotely on a server over an ssh session and e. Unfortunately when i checked the aix machine i work on does not the unix and linux forums. Lftp can be used as any typical ftp client but it also provides the ability to connect without asking about the password. Though there is a lot of free documentation available, the.

If site is specified then lftp will connect to that site otherwise a connection has to. You could use lftp it handles ftps with ease and make a lftp script lftp script. Linux command line for you and me documentation, release 0. This entry was posted in linux and tagged file transfer, ftp, lftp. Lftp is an alternative to the ftp command set, which supports many protocols and offers countless parameters.

You can also mirror with the data that is not in working local directory, for example with such command. If site is specified then lftp will connect to that site otherwise a connection has to be established with the open command. How to use the linux ftp command to up and download files. It has bookmarks, a builtin mirror command, and can transfer several files in parallel. Using lftp ftp to mirrortransfer files from one server to another may, 2012 5 comments standard post if youve been using linux for a while you have probably used scp or rsync to transfer files between two linux servers. Lftp is a command line ftp client well loved by many. Linux mint uses ubuntu repositories more on what this means later and is fully compatible with it so most of the resources, articles, tutorials, and software made for page 6 of 50. Using lftp ftp to mirrortransfer files from one server. This fedora 29 tutorial is for those that want to know all the different ways and the best way i prefer to install. Sftp, which stands for ssh file transfer protocol, or secure file transfer protocol, is a separate protocol packaged with ssh that works in a similar way over a secure connection. Lftp is a sophisticated file transfer program supporting a number of network protocols ftp, sftp, fish, torrent. Lftp is a more robust ftp client than just plain ftp or curl.

Is it possible to set lftp command to only work with ssltls connection. Many people still believe that learning linux is difficult, or that only experts can understand how a linux system works. How to sendget a file tofrom a remote server via command. In this video, i breakdown the various ways on how to install programs on linux. The only issue i had was turning off the verify certificate and setting that to no. To see just the description of a manual page, use whatis followed by a string. Shell script lftp howtoforge linux howtos and tutorials. The program also supports fxp and simple bittorrent protocol support. Today i was trying to make the ftp backup for wordpress work but my centos webserver got stuck at making data connection when using lftp for the file transfer.

In this tutorial, i will explain how to use the linux ftp command on the shell. Gnu linux is a collaborative effort between the gnu project, formed in 1983 to develop the gnu operating system and the development team of linux, a kernel. How to sendget a file tofrom a remote server via command line or script. I need to set up a script on a linux machine to download files from a server using ftps, what options do i have. How to use sftp to securely transfer files with a remote. How to use the linux ftp command to up and download files on. Since lftp is a ftp client, to work with it we would need to have some ftp server setup. These tools endlessly waste time downloading useless index html pages. Hi there, im new to shell scripting and need some help if possible.

This script only works one way, so if you remove the file on your server, it will not be removed from your home directory. This tutorial is based on the topics covered in the gnu make book. How to setup lftp a simple command line ftp program. How to install programs on linux fedora 29 tutorial youtube. Using lftp ftp to mirrortransfer files from one server to. How to use lftp command for ftps client or to connect. Unlike those clients, it retries a few times when transmission fails, has mirroring features, and supports simultaneous multifile transfers, recursion. This tutorial teaches about lftp, how to install and how to use lftp in linux distributions. Client decides weather to connect passively or actively and. Remove a line from a file using sed useful for updating known ssh server keys when they change for example, to remove line 5. Like bash, it has job control and uses the readline library for input. The actual backups are easy as they are done by simple scripts on the servers which are called by.

Discussion in programmingscripts started by tsvikash, sep 4, 2008. Apr 01, 2017 icon typeunixhow do i mirror files from remote ftp server using lftp command. Several methods can be used and using lftp seems to be the simplest. Sophisticated file transfer program linux man page. This tutorial will explain how to use an automated lftp script that runs every few minutes or of your choosing matching a remote directory with your home. So lets set up a basic ftp server that we will use for our demonstration of lftp features. In my case i run mget c lftp command for getting all logs from java spring boot application running linux app instance. By default, ls output is cached, to see newlisting use rels or cache. The file is already on remote server and i want to have a copy of it with diffrent name and directory. You use ftp to transfer files fromto your computer tofrom a server. Lftp is a commandline file transfer program ftp client for unix and unixlike systems.

Nov 23, 2018 in this video, i breakdown the various ways on how to install programs on linux. It was developed by alexander lukyanov, and is distributed under the gnu general public license. I have read through the whole man lftp 1 and it seems that the way you have chosen is actually the best one command doesnt support direct combination with another commands, as you tried put lftp batch script 12 nov 2015. If you use ls command without any argument, then it will work on the current directory. The linux command line second internet edition william e. Ftp tutorial ftp from the laptops ftp from the desktops note. For example, this may be useful for scripts with multiple get commands. Commandline ftps not sftp client for linux closed ask question asked 10 years. This book is part of the project, a site for linux education and advo cacy devoted. If you ftp to your server account, your password will not be encrypted you could compromise your account ftp stands for file transfer protocol. How to use lftp to accelerate ftps download speed on. Install and configure ftp server in redhatcentos linux. One comment on using lftp with ftps explicit ssl encryption.

Lftp is a commandline based file transfer software also known as ftp client which was developed by alexander lukyanov and was distributed as gnu general public license. Linux desktop testing project ldtp is aimed at producing high quality test automation framework and cuttingedge tools that can be used to test gnu linux desktop and improve it. Hi everyone, this article is about lftp and how we can install lftp in our linux operating system. How do put the entire directory from a local disk to a remote ftp server reverse mirror using lftp command under linux and unix like operating systems. This idea has been extended to microsoft windows as cobra, mac os x as atomac. This manual page was originally written by christoph lameter.

As we can see it supports popular data and file transfer protocols. Lftp is available on unix systems solaris, linux, etc as well as windows it is included in the standard list of packages for cygwin. By joining our community you will have the ability to post topics, receive our newsletter, use the advanced search, subscribe to threads and access many other special features. How to setup lftp a simple command line ftp program linoxide.

1166 749 437 168 644 698 400 1522 1293 842 1023 1241 571 805 28 1266 607 1171 775 1181 651 974 217 85 1356 1299 923 1524 1531 872 58 400 926 161 804 268 41 1130 1211 373 643 533 493 1004 1491 1360 539 979 1041